Padres send Cashner to Double-A

MILWAUKEE (AP) The San Diego Padres optioned right-hander Andrew Cashner to Double-A San Antonio and called up right-hander Brad Boxberger from Triple-A Tucson.

Cashner got the start in the Padres' 5-2 win Saturday over the Milwaukee Brewers. He gave up two hits and one run over 2 1/3 innings, striking out five and walking two.

Padres manager Bud Black said Cashner would begin his transition from reliever to starter.

"I think there's durability in the delivery, I think there's resiliency in the arm that's going to enable him to log innings," Black said.

Boxberger has made 22 relief appearances for Tucson, going 1-2 with five saves and a 4.70 ERA.
